Mixed Raster Content (MRC) compression is designed to create compact PDF files from image-only source files containing both text and color or grayscale pictures or backgrounds, by separating the elements and applying optimized compression to each of them.
This setting is applied during WriteDocument() when OutputManager.Format is:
- "Converters.Text.PDF"
- "Converters.Text.PDFImageOnText"
- "Converters.Text.PDFImageSubst"
- "Converters.Text.PDFEdited"
By default, this setting is Off, but can be enabled by setting the Recognition.MrcQuality property to a supported grade:
- Low - Recognized output is saved with degraded image quality, but can produce the smallest PDF file.
- Medium - Recognized output is saved with reduced image quality, but can produce a smaller PDF file.
- High - Recognized output is saved without losing image quality, but produces a larger PDF file.
For example, to export recognition output to an Image Over Text PDF using medium MRC quality:
C# |
Copy Code |
igRecognition.Recognition.MrcQuality = ImGearRecMrcQuality.Medium;
igRecognition.OutputManager.Format = "Converters.Text.PDFImageOnText";
igRecognition.OutputManager.WriteDocument(igRecDocument, "OCR-MrcQualityMedium.pdf"); |
VB.NET |
Copy Code |
igRecognition.Recognition.MrcQuality = ImGearRecMrcQuality.Medium
igRecognition.OutputManager.Format = "Converters.Text.PDFImageOnText"
igRecognition.OutputManager.WriteDocument(igRecDocument, "OCR-MrcQualityMedium.pdf") |